DDenise KSTMe and my mum stayed in this hotel for 4 nights. Two of the main reasons I booked this hotel were because of its excellent location and they have front sea view room available on the dates I wanted.
Let’s talk about the positive first. The seaview in our room was amazing and the location was perfect. Easy to go around, restaurants and bars and grocery are all walking distance. Bus 101 and 102 right next to the hotel can take us to all the tourist attractions nearby.
The balcony door was so soundproof that despite located in the middle of the center, we barely hear anything once the door was closed.
They did surprise us with a compliment bottle of champagne when we arrived as I mentioned that it was my mum’s birthday trip.
It is definitely a family oriented hotel if you have kids with you. They did have some sort of program daily for the kids to join and having a calm white sand beach right in front of the hotel is definitely something you want to have when travelling with kids.
Now comes to the negative. First of all, the service was definitely not I would expect from a 5 stars hotel. We arrived with a taxi, there was two bellboy approached our taxi which I thought they would helped with our luggage as we were all female including the taxi driver. However the older bellboy just stand there when me and the taxi driver were unloading the luggage from the taxi. He was literally right next to me and watched me struggle a bit with the luggage and did not even lift a finger. The older guy then told the younger one to take our luggage to the lobby after me and the driver unloaded it from the taxi. Honestly I found it quite unacceptable for a 5 stars hotel.
The receptionist that greeted us was nice and she gave me all the information I needed and brought us a welcome drink which it did immediately make me feel better.
The room was definitely dated, no toothbrush or cotton bud and cotton pads were presented in the room. Only shower gel and shampoo was provided ( no actual conditioner). It was fine for us as we always carry and use our own but I would expect those amenity to be already present in the room of a 5 stars hotel. Bed was extremely soft but we did not end up with back pain waking up so I think it was fine. All in all , the room was definitely not posh or what one might expect from a 5 stars hotel.
Then when we tried to reserve for the sunbed, there was not much available so we ended up on the grass but not next to the pool but I guess that’s just our luck and the hotel was pretty packed so can’t do much about it.
Breakfast in the hotel was ok. Quality was fair. Same food everyday. Freddo coffee is not included apparently. Service at the breakfast was 50/50. There were staffs that were smiling and greeting us and even remembering us ( all were from south Asian) and there were staffs with a poker face and just come collect our plate without even asking us if we still was eating. One Manager just stand there observing with a kind of upset face and zero interaction with customers. Another was annoyed by the staffs as some seem to not knowing which area they should be working in. As someone that works in hospitality I could sense that it was not a happy environment to work in. It seems like they were hiring inexperienced staffs and provide them only basic training at the peak season just so they can deal with the high amount of customers. The tension was high and even the customer can feel it looking at their interactions. By 10:30am they would try to collect everything on the table even you might still be working on the breakfast as they have to prepare for the lunch hour for the all inclusive plan customers.
I would not say it was a bad stay. I still did enjoy my time there in this hotel. However I think the hotel did not quite meet the standard of a 5 stars hotel.
Next time when I go back, I would tried their other sister hotel—sunrise pearl/ sunrise jade as they do look more posh and new.

UUtente ospiteLocation was great, close to several beaches. There’s a shuttle that can give you a ride to the nearest one but unfortunately was out of service during my stay - I do recommend Konnos and Fig Tree beaches that are slightly farther. The spa services (e.g. massage, exfoliation & hydration, etc.) were very underwhelming and not worth the price. The bathroom had the previous guest’s hair strands on the shower’s wall and mold in the tile’s crevices - a person was sent to “clean up” after a call to the reception. On the other hand, breakfast was great and inclusive. Pool was nice and the bar was right next to it with drinks and quick snacks (e.g. salads, club sandwiches, wraps, etc). Parking was also accessible and easy.
Overall, the stay was good but the cleanliness and spa services should really be focused on by the facility.
